MinIO C++ SDK
Public Member Functions | List of all members
minio::s3::ComposeSource Struct Reference
Inheritance diagram for minio::s3::ComposeSource:
minio::s3::ObjectConditionalReadArgs minio::s3::ObjectReadArgs minio::s3::ObjectVersionArgs minio::s3::ObjectArgs minio::s3::BucketArgs minio::s3::BaseArgs

Public Member Functions

error::Error BuildHeaders (size_t object_size, std::string etag)
 
size_t ObjectSize ()
 
utils::Multimap Headers ()
 
- Public Member Functions inherited from minio::s3::ObjectConditionalReadArgs
utils::Multimap Headers ()
 
utils::Multimap CopyHeaders ()
 
- Public Member Functions inherited from minio::s3::ObjectArgs
error::Error Validate ()
 
- Public Member Functions inherited from minio::s3::BucketArgs
error::Error Validate ()
 

Additional Inherited Members

- Public Attributes inherited from minio::s3::ObjectConditionalReadArgs
size_t * offset = NULL
 
size_t * length = NULL
 
std::string match_etag
 
std::string not_match_etag
 
utils::Time modified_since
 
utils::Time unmodified_since
 
- Public Attributes inherited from minio::s3::ObjectReadArgs
SseCustomerKeyssec = NULL
 
- Public Attributes inherited from minio::s3::ObjectVersionArgs
std::string version_id
 
- Public Attributes inherited from minio::s3::ObjectArgs
std::string object
 
- Public Attributes inherited from minio::s3::BucketArgs
std::string bucket
 
std::string region
 
- Public Attributes inherited from minio::s3::BaseArgs
utils::Multimap extra_headers
 
utils::Multimap extra_query_params
 

The documentation for this struct was generated from the following files: